<p>A titanium alloy having high elastic deformation capacity, characterized in that it consists substantially of a Va Group element and titanium and has a tensile strength at elastic limit of 950 Mpa or more and an elastic deformation capacity of 1.6 % or more; and a method for producing the titanium alloy which comprises a cold working step of applying a cold working of 10 % or more to a raw material for a titanium alloy consisting substantially of a Va Group element and titanium and an aging treatment step of subjecting the resultant cold-worked material to an aging treatment under conditions wherein a temperature is 150 to 600 °C and a Larson-Miller parameter (P) is 8.0 to 18.5. The titanium alloy exhibits a high elastic deformation capacity and a high tensile strength at elastic limit and thus can be used for various products in a wide range of applications.</p> |
